O's Weekly Wrap: Sept 24th - 29th

The O's finished 2013 well, securing a winning season for the second year in a row.

Standings

The O's finished the season at 85-77, tied for third place in the AL East with the Yankees (12 GB) and 6 GB of a Wild Card spot.

Results

The O's went 4-2 in the last week of the season, 2-1 to take the series from Toronto and 2-1 to take the final series of the year from the Red Sox.

Run Differential

-3, but most of those runs allowed came in the 12-3 laugher against Boston.

Best Hitter / Worst Hitter

Brian Roberts takes the title of Best Hitter this week, as he hit .364/.391/.682 (195 wRC+) to finish out the season. J.J. Hardy went the other direction, hitting .333/.333/.375 (92 wRC+) in the final week.

Best Pitcher / Worst Pitcher

Miguel Gonzalez finished the year off strong: 7 IP, 0 ER, 5 K, BB. Scott Feldman turned in a clunker of a start: 2.1 IP, 8 ER, 1 K, 0 BB, 1 HR.
